This is a solution for the IP Address Tracker challenge on Frontend Mentor.
- React
- Axios
- IP Geolocation API
- React Leaflet (for displaying the map)
This project includes the following features:
- IP address lookup functionality
- Displaying the user's location on a map using React Leaflet
- Retrieving detailed information about an IP address using the IP Geolocation API
- Displaying relevant data, such as IP address, location, timezone, and ISP
To use this project, clone or download the repository to your local machine. Navigate to the project directory and run npm install
to install the required dependencies. Then, run npm start
to start the development server and open the application in your browser.
Enter an IP address in the search field, and the application will retrieve and display the corresponding location information and show it on the map.
The project utilizes the IP Geolocation API to fetch information about the IP address, and React Leaflet to display the map. The Axios library is used to handle HTTP requests.
- Frontend Mentor for providing the challenge
- IP Geolocation API for providing IP geolocation data
- React Leaflet for the map display functionality
Please note that this is just an example, and you can customize the content and structure based on your project's specific details.